What they do

An Academic or Guidance Counselor provides guidance to students in elementary, middle and high schools to help them succeed academically and socially. Works with school teachers and administrators to address problems that affect student performance, and identifies resources for students and families. Helps high school students to plan academic course work and advises on the college search and application process.
